Is this a FTF caused by the notched hammer most AR lowers have? Most of the dedicated .22 upper manufacturers recomend changing the hammer out to a smooth hammer (notch filled in).

My bad, I did not mean FTF(Fail to Feed). I was thinking Fail to Fire. So it would fire then eject, then the next round would not discharge. I believe the BCG did not engage far enough. I did inspect the rim of the round and it had a slight indent where the pin hit head. I also have the correct hammer in the rifle, it was a DPMS LPK I installed in the lower. I'm going to try some different ammo and see what happens, also it is brand new and I think it just needs to be broke in. The BCG was also very tight.
